Output 2d340eb8753205c7a871a8b8362b0bc6910babb722ad1051e2a844f316ec7e1b:0

value
105400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c649a426a99a46c73cce40ae6441b4a3929350f3 OP_EQUAL
address
3KmTwCzFxBbAQGTXqkmdK33ADUy6Y6VFJV
transaction
2d340eb8753205c7a871a8b8362b0bc6910babb722ad1051e2a844f316ec7e1b
confirmations
285219
spent
true